In 2026, the USDA loan limit for Malakoff in the county of Henderson, TX, is $336,500. Meanwhile, the FHA limit for a single-family home is set at $472,030.

| Loan Type | Loan Limit | Down Payment |
| USDA | $336,500 | 0% |
| FHA | $472,030 | 3.5% |
| Conventional Conforming | $726,200 | 3% |

A USDA home loan, guaranteed by the Department of Agriculture and also known as a USDA rural development loan or USDA mortgage, is specifically available in rural neighborhoods. Unlike FHA loans that necessitate a minimum 3.5% down payment, USDA mortgages require no down payment.
